Abstract (EN)
In our society, thyroid diseases such as nodular goiter are followed closely due to the risk of conversion to malignancy, therefore thyroid diseases constitute a serious population in outpatient clinics in practice. Among the thyroid malignancies that make up 1% of all malignancies, the most common type is papillary thyroid cancer with 80%. Fine Needle Aspiration Biopsy (FNAB) plays an important role in the cytological evaluation of thyroid nodules. The malignancy rate is 10-30% in thyroid nodules with atypia of uncertain significance according to the Bethesda Classification as a result of thyroid fine-needle aspiration biopsy. In thyroid nodules evaluated as atypia of uncertain significance as a result of fine needle aspiration biopsy, early diagnosis and surgical decision with the suspicion of malignancy are of great importance. In many recent studies, the importance of the relationship between cancer risk and inflammation is increasing. Pan immune inflammation index (PIV), systemic immune inflammation index (SII) and neutrophil lymphocyte ratio (NLR) calculated with a simple blood count are the markers showing systemic inflammation. PIV, SII and NLR have an important place for diagnosis, prognosis and treatment follow-up in many cancer types. In our study, thyroid fine-needle aspiration biopsy results of patients with atypia of uncertain significance were compared with those with malignant or benign post-surgical final pathology in terms of neutrophil-lymphocyte ratio, systemic immune inflammation index, and pan immune inflammation index, which are systemic immune inflammation markers. Between January 2017 and December 2022, 120 patients who underwent total thyroidectomy with atypia of uncertain significance as a result of fine needle aspiration biopsy from the thyroid nodule in the General Surgery Clinic of Fırat University Faculty of Medicine were examined. Sixty of these patients had thyroid diseases with a benign character and 60 with a malignant character, with a definitive postoperative pathology report. The mean PIV value of the patients included in the study in the benign thyroid disease group was 217.64, the mean SII value was 502.64, and the N/L ratio was 1.875. In the group with malignant thyroid disease, the mean PIV value was 327.95, the mean SII value was 644.56, and the N/L ratio was 2.26. PIV, SII, N/L ratios of the group with malignant thyroid disease were found to be statistically significantly higher than those of benign thyroid diseases. As a result of our study, it was observed that NLR, SII and PIV values calculated by complete blood count before surgery in patients with atypia of uncertain significance as a result of FNAB were higher in the group of patients whose pathology was malignant after surgery than in the benign thyroid disease group. İn conclusion, our study showed that if the PIV, SII, and NLR values calculated in patients with atypia of uncertain significance in FNAB results are found to be high in the first biopsies, it can support malignancy, thus surgery can be recommended to the patient without the need for a second biopsy. Moreover; If the calculated PIV, SII and NLR values are found to be low in the first biopsies, it is anticipated that radiological follow-up of the nodules can be recommended without recommending surgery to the patient.
